Abstract
A dual phase shifting mask (PSM)/double exposure lithographic process for manufacturing a shrunk semiconductor device. A semiconductor wafer having a photoresist layer coated thereon is provided. A first phase shift mask is disposed over the semiconductor wafer and implementing a first exposure process to expose the photoresist layer to light transmitted through the first phase shift mask so as to form a latent pattern comprising a peripheral unexposed line pattern in the photoresist layer. The first phase shift mask is then replaced with a second phase shift mask and implementing a second exposure process to expose the photoresist layer to light transmitted through the second phase shift mask so as to remove the peripheral unexposed line pattern.
